Welcome to the world of Artificial Intelligence (AI) and its fascinating fundamentals. In this comprehensive guide, we will explore the essential concepts and components that form the backbone of AI. Whether you are new to AI or seeking to strengthen your understanding, this article will provide you with a solid foundation to navigate the exciting realm of AI technologies.
Machine Learning vs. Deep Learning:
Machine Learning and Deep Learning are two subfields of AI that play a crucial role in enabling machines to learn and make intelligent decisions. Machine Learning involves algorithms that learn from data and improve their performance over time without explicit programming. It focuses on training models to recognize patterns and make predictions. On the other hand, Deep Learning, inspired by the structure of the human brain, utilizes neural networks with multiple layers to process and learn from vast amounts of data, leading to powerful insights and complex decision-making capabilities.
Neural Networks and their Components:
Neural Networks are at the core of many AI advancements. They are mathematical models inspired by the human brain's interconnected network of neurons. Neural Networks consist of layers of interconnected nodes called neurons, each performing specific computations. These layers typically include an input layer, hidden layers, and an output layer. Each neuron applies mathematical transformations to input data, and information flows through the network, enabling the system to learn and make predictions.
Key components of Neural Networks include:
- Neurons: Individual computational units within the network.
- Weights: Parameters that determine the strength of connections between neurons.
- Activation Functions: Functions applied to the output of neurons to introduce non-linearity and model complex relationships.
- Bias: An additional term that adjusts the output of a neuron.
- Backpropagation: The process of fine-tuning the weights and biases of a neural network based on the evaluation of its predictions.
Supervised, Unsupervised, and Reinforcement Learning:
Supervised Learning is a machine learning technique where models are trained on labeled datasets. The model learns from input-output pairs and generalizes to make predictions on unseen data. This approach is commonly used for tasks such as classification and regression.
Unsupervised Learning, on the other hand, involves training models on unlabeled data, allowing them to learn patterns and structures without explicit supervision. Unsupervised Learning is beneficial for tasks like clustering, anomaly detection, and dimensionality reduction.
Reinforcement Learning takes inspiration from how humans learn through trial and error. In this paradigm, an agent interacts with an environment and learns to make sequential decisions to maximize rewards. Reinforcement Learning is applicable to complex tasks like game-playing, robotics, and autonomous systems.
As we conclude this exploration of the fundamentals of AI, it becomes evident that Machine Learning, Deep Learning, Neural Networks, and various learning paradigms form the bedrock of AI advancements. By grasping these foundational concepts, you have taken a significant step in understanding the exciting field of AI and its diverse applications.
This article has provided you with a glimpse into the world of AI fundamentals, including Machine Learning vs. Deep Learning, Neural Networks and their components, as well as Supervised, Unsupervised, and Reinforcement Learning. Armed with this knowledge, you are well-equipped to further explore and delve into the vast realms of AI and its limitless potential.
Remember, this is just the beginning. The field of AI is dynamic and ever-evolving, offering endless possibilities and opportunities. Embrace your curiosity, continue learning, and stay engaged with the latest developments to unlock the true potential of AI.
Now, go forth and embark on your AI journey with confidence and enthusiasm!